In honor of Women's History Month, I want to tell you about a woman named Ann Rowe. She was African American. She designed Jackie Kennedy's wedding gown and created ball room gowns for wealthy white women. Because of her race, she was not always recognized for her incredible, beautiful work.

Mr. George Johnson at 97 years old, has published his memoirs. His book is about how he started and built his company, Johnson Product Company, into an empire. His products, like Ultra Sheen and Afro Sheen, revolutionized hair care for Black folk. His story is impressive. Order on Amazon
